The Best Ground Troops for Dominance
Ground troops are the workhorses of any army, absorbing damage and clearing a path for your more fragile units. Here are the top ground troops you should consider:
Hog Riders: Hog Riders are a favorite among players due to their speed and ability to jump over walls. They excel at taking out defenses quickly, especially when paired with Healers to keep them alive.
Golems: As the toughest ground troop in the game, Golems are perfect for absorbing damage while your other troops wreak havoc. Pair them with Wizards or Wall Breakers for maximum impact.
Barbarians: Simple yet effective, Barbarians are great for overwhelming defenses with sheer numbers. They’re especially useful in early-game strategies.
Air Troops: The Game-Changers
Air troops bring a whole new dimension to battle, capable of bypassing ground defenses and targeting key structures. Here are the best air troops to include in your army:
Dragons: The Dragon is a powerhouse in Clash of Clans. With high health and area damage, it’s perfect for clearing clusters of defenses. Use it to soften up the enemy base before your ground troops move in.
Minions: Fast and cheap to produce, Minions are ideal for cleaning up remaining structures after your heavier troops have done their work.

Special Troops: The X-Factor
Special troops are what set a good army apart from a great one. These unique units provide game-changing abilities that can turn the tide of any battle:
Healers: Healers are invaluable when paired with high-damage troops like Hog Riders or Golems. They keep your troops alive, allowing them to inflict maximum damage.
Wall Breakers: These small but mighty troops are essential for breaching walls. Use them strategically to create pathways for your ground troops.

Final Tips for Success
Experiment with Different Combinations: Every base is unique, so be prepared to adapt your troop choices based on the enemy’s defenses.
Upgrade Your Troops Regularly: Higher-level troops have significantly better stats, making them far more effective in battle.
Watch Replays: Analyze your battles to identify weaknesses and improve your strategy
